Common Welding Qualifications

While the American Welding Society’s basic CW (Certified Welder) certification paves the way for the majority of positions, specific fields require a specialized certification. A handful of the most-common of these are listed below.

  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for welders that deal with pipelines in the oil and gas industry
  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als who deal with boiler and pressurized containers
  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certifications for inspectors and senior inspectors
  • Certified Welder Certificates to be a Certified Welder

The table illustrates wage and employment estimates for professional welders in the State of Montana through the end of the decade.

Montana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 1,320 1,440 10% 50
Montana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$23,400 $33,800 $58,100

Source: O*Net Online

Even though you might have decided upon which school or program to sign up for, you should really check if the training course has the proper accreditation with the AWS. After looking into the accreditation situation, you will need to search a little bit further to make certain that the training program you like can provide you with the best instruction.

  • Search for colleges that comply with AWS SENSE standards
  • Be certain the institution teaches with gear that suits the latest industry guidelines
  • See if the facility offers financial assistance
  • Be sure the school’s program features courses in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
